Pope Leo advocates for regulation of artificial intelligence in encyclical

In his inaugural encyclical, Pope Leo called for significant regulation of artificial intelligence, advocating for measures to address potential dangers like war and economic instability. His remarks were further analyzed in a discussion with Christopher Hale.

Pope Leo emphasized the need for regulation of artificial intelligence (AI) in his first papal encyclical, suggesting that AI should be 'disarmed' to mitigate potential risks such as war and economic disruption. This statement was discussed by Amna Nawaz with Christopher Hale, who authors 'Letters from Leo' on Substack.
